Discover the allure of this charming home, blending modern comfort with historic charm. Nestled on a quiet, friendly street yet steps away from the vibrant Queen Anne Ave N with easy access to excellent dining & coffee shops. Walk to Kerry Park for the most iconic Seattle view, and enjoy a great selection of eateries no matter what time of day! This two level vintage home offers a living room, dining room, family room, three bedrooms, and two full baths. The home is tastefully furnished and is cozy and spacious. With a dedicated parking spot and plenty of street parking, your stay in Seattle promises convenience and relaxation!

**Floor Plan**
• Main Floor: Main entrance, living room w/ smart TV and fireplace, dining room, kitchen, 2 bedrooms w/ queen beds, full bath, elevated deck off the kitchen with spacious outdoor seating and BBQ.
• Lower floor: Family room w/ smart TV, bedroom w/ queen bed, bath, laundry.

    This house has a wonderful location at the top of Queen Anne, a great kitchen with nice equipment, a terrific dining table for real meals, lovely decor, comfy beds, room to spread out, nice deck with a view to the east (we saw the waning gibbous moon), great showers, - in short, it was excellent and I'd stay there again next time I'm in Seattle ! Walking almost everywhere we wanted to go was easy and challenging (in a good way) at the same time... the stairs all over the place to downtown were impressive, we came up along WestLake to Highland to Galer and climbed up so many stairs, was a great working. We walked to Paramount Theater, Pike Market, Le Pichet, and all over the place. I had thought we'd use the bus too, but the weather was terrific and we needed the exercise. The neighborhood itself had great restaurants and Trader Joe's right around the corner. We had lunch at Bounty Kitchen, it was very delicious and super nice people ! and The Moonrise Bakery has the best ham and cheese croissant I've ever had.Felt like a place I'd love to live, honestly !
